Output 43fda83bdfbe30d3cfd22e7e6055cf6222f9ecd30ef419ef8bf4263523c88005:0

value
3880593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03f969124e74672b9543ebe5d1191e0c8b1cf3b OP_EQUAL
address
3PbLGmLp8sEioUpRCsGC8F1BCF1UtQgaFu
transaction
43fda83bdfbe30d3cfd22e7e6055cf6222f9ecd30ef419ef8bf4263523c88005
spent
true